Exploring the Variability of House Clearance Costs

Many individuals expect house clearance companies to provide a fixed price for their services.
The truth is, each property is unique.
For instance, a one-bedroom flat in Weymouth Town Centre may have minimal furnishings and could be cleared in just a few hours. In contrast, a large detached family home in Preston that has been occupied for decades may require multiple team members, several trips in vehicles, and significant disposal costs.
The final cost will depend on several factors including:
- Size of the property
- Amount of contents
- Types of items being removed
- Accessibility of the property
- Labour requirements
- Disposal fees
- Recycling options
- Presence of high-value items
This is why accurate quotations usually necessitate a site visit or detailed information regarding the items to be cleared.

The Volume of Contents: A Key Cost Factor
Many customers assume that house clearance pricing is primarily determined by the number of bedrooms.
In reality, the total volume of contents within the property is often the most significant factor influencing costs.
For example:
A nearly empty four-bedroom detached home may be less expensive to clear than a heavily furnished two-bedroom bungalow packed with years of belongings.
Common items that add to house clearance costs include:
- Sofas
- Beds
- Wardrobes
- Dining furniture
- White goods
- Books
- Clothing
- Household items
- Garden tools
- Loft contents
- Garage items
The more items that require removal, the higher the associated labour and disposal fees will be.

Comparing House Clearance Costs with Skip Hire Options
Homeowners frequently weigh house clearance services against skip hire alternatives.
Skip Hire
Usually involves:
- Heavy lifting
- Sorting waste
- Self-loading
- Possible permit applications
House Clearance
Includes:
- Labour
- Removal
- Transportation
- Disposal
For many customers, professional clearance services provide far greater convenience.
